Son Heung-min’s contract with Tottenham Hotspur, signed in 2020, places him among the club’s top earners. He receives a weekly wage of approximately £200,000, translating to an annual salary of over £10 million from football alone.
In addition to his base salary, Son benefits from performance-related bonuses, which reward him for goals, assists, appearances, and team achievements. These bonuses can significantly boost his total annual earnings, contingent upon his and the team’s performance.
Son’s clean image and high profile make him a highly sought-after brand ambassador. He has lucrative endorsement deals with global brands such as Adidas, for whom he also designs custom football boots, and various South Korean companies across multiple sectors.
Son’s endorsement deals extend to brand ambassador roles for major international companies, showcasing products, participating in advertising campaigns, and engaging with fans via social media.
His commercial partnerships span industries from electronics to beverages, each adding significantly to his overall income through campaigns, promotions, and appearances.
Historically, Heung Min Son’s net worth has grown steadily since he began his professional career in Germany’s Bundesliga. His move to Tottenham Hotspur and subsequent rise to global stardom have significantly amplified his earnings over the years.
Son is known for maintaining a disciplined and modest lifestyle despite his wealth. He prioritizes family, health, and personal well-being, avoiding the extravagant spending habits seen in many elite athletes. His financial philosophy emphasizes saving and investing wisely, focusing on long-term stability.
When compared to other top footballers, Son is well-compensated but does not reach the highest echelons occupied by superstars like Lionel Messi, Cristiano Ronaldo, and Neymar. This is due in part to the length of their careers at the top and their more substantial endorsement deals. Nevertheless, Heung Min Son remains among the highest-earning Asian footballers of all time.
